Very simple! Just open the app, give it storage permissions, and then import your music files into the library. After importing, there is no need to connect to the Internet at all, which is very cool!
Of course! Go to Settings> Music Management, click the "Music Scan" function, and it will automatically help you import and organize your music files, saving you trouble and effort ~
Click into the "Songlist" area, press "Create New Songlist", add songs, save, and finish! If you want to change or delete a song list, you can operate it in the app at any time without pressure.
It eats all common formats such as MP3, WAV, and FLAC, and the playback quality is excellent, so you can listen comfortably!
Find the "Equalizer" function in the Settings, select a preset mode, or manually drag the slider to adjust it. You can listen to whatever style you want!
Yes! Go to Settings> Theme, which has more than 20 themes to choose from, including light and dark modes. Choose whatever you want!
